Kicking it Up a Notch: S Players at Open Programs like Kahuku Red Raiders

๐Ÿ“ Kahuku Red RaidersยทMonday, July 20, 2026ยทFridayNightPulse Insider

At the heart of every successful defensive back is exceptional footwork. To improve your S players' agility and reaction time, incorporate the 'Ladder Weave' drill into your summer camp regimen. Set up a ladder on the field with 10-12 rungs. Divide your S players into pairs, with one player at each end of the ladder. On the whistle, the first player must weave through the ladder, then immediately change direction and weave back through. The second player repeats the process. Complete 3 sets of 5 reps each. Coaching cue: 'Quick feet, quick hands.' This drill translates to game performance by improving reaction time and allowing S players to stay in phase with receivers. By mastering the Ladder Weave, your S players will be better equipped to handle the speed and agility of opposing wideouts.
